About the store
When I first started teaching, lesson planning was a time-consuming task that often felt overwhelming. Unfortunately, this challenge doesn’t always get easier with experience. On top of creating rigorous, engaging content for your students, there are those unexpected days where you need a quick solution, whether due to an emergency or the need for a substitute teacher. My goal is to support teachers in these moments of need with ready-to-use materials. I provide a variety of resources designed specifically to ease your workload and meet classroom needs. Here's what you can find in my store: Classroom Notes: Comprehensive notes for daily lessons, tailored for different classroom dynamics, including independent learners. Videos: Instructional videos that accompany the notes. Perfect for days when you have a substitute or when you want to free up time in your own lessons to focus on student questions. Practice Problems: A collection of problems for reviewing and reinforcing material. Ideal for use in class, as homework, or as a substitute-friendly activity. Google Forms: Interactive assessments that instantly gauge student understanding and provide you with immediate feedback on their grasp of the content. Overall, I am here to help meet the needs that you have as a teacher and I am hopeful that you find the material that I have to be useful. Teaching style

In regards to my teaching style, I mainly use an exploration-based approach. However, I understand that many substitute teachers will find this challenging to implement if they do not have a strong background in Math. Thus, my substitute plans will focus on instruction that is more traditional.

Additional biographical information

I was born and raised in Montana and currently live in Virginia with my husband and son. I have taught integrated Math 1, PreCalculus, and Geometry. I love teaching and helping students to grasp the concepts behind the material.
